Understanding Calibration and Its Importance Calibration is critical for any laboratory instrument as it directly affects the accuracy of the measurements taken. Without proper calibration, even the most sophisticated equipment can yield erroneous results, leading to flawed research outcomes. The calibration process involves comparing the instrument's readings with known standards and making necessary adjustments to align them accurately.

However, some drawbacks exist. Depending on the supplier, there might be limited availability of specific models, and there could be concerns among researchers about the stigma associated with using refurbished equipment. Furthermore, warranty coverage may vary, requiring thorough scrutiny when selecting a supplier.

Additionally, a rigorous testing protocol is typically employed during the refurbishment process. This protocol often mirrors the quality assurance measures used in manufacturing new equipment, ensuring that refurbished instruments deliver reliable performance across various applications. For example, suppose a lab acquires a refurbished chromatograph. In that case, it can expect the same precision and accuracy in its measurements as it would from a new model, provided the refurbishment is conducted by a trusted service provider.

However, one must be wary of the possibility of purchasing subpar or poorly refurbished instruments. This underscores the necessity of sourcing equipment from reputable suppliers who provide thorough documentation, warranties, and customer support. Investing time in due diligence before a purchase can mitigate these risks and lead to optimal outcomes.
